期刊论文详细信息
ETRI Journal | |
A Novel Globally Adaptive Load-Balanced Routing Algorithm for Torus Interconnection Networks | |
关键词: deadlock; traffic pattern; load-balance; adaptive routing algorithms; torus interconnection networks; | |
Others : 1185571 DOI : 10.4218/etrij.07.0206.0241 |
|
【 摘 要 】
A globally adaptive load-balanced routing algorithm for torus interconnection networks is proposed. Unlike previously published algorithms, this algorithm employs a new scheme based on collision detection to handle deadlock, and has higher routing adaptability than previous algorithms. Simulation results show that our algorithm outperforms previous algorithms by 16% on benign traffic patterns, and by 10% to 21% on adversarial traffic patterns.
【 授权许可】
【 预 览 】
Files | Size | Format | View |
---|---|---|---|
20150520112439818.pdf | 245KB | download |
【 参考文献 】
- [1]J. Duato, S. Yalamanchili, and L. Ni, Interconnection Networks: An Engineering Approach, revised edition, Morgan Kaufmann, San Francisco, 2002.
- [2]W.J. Dally, "Scalable Switching Fabrics for Internet Routers," Whitepaper, Avici Systems. http://www.avici.com/technology/ whitepapers/
- [3]A. Singh, W.J. Dally, and A.K. Gupta, "GOAL: A Load-Balanced Adaptive Routing Algorithm for Torus Networks," Proc. 30th Annual Int. Symp. Computer Architecture, 2003, pp. 194-205.
- [4]A. Singh, W.J. Dally, and B. Towles, "Globally Adaptive Load-Balanced Routing on Tori," IEEE Computer Architecture Letters, vol. 1, 2004, pp. 2-5.
- [5]K. Bolding, M.L. Fulgham, and L. Snyder, "The Case for Chaotic Adaptive Routing," IEEE Trans. Computers, vol. 12, 1997, pp. 1281-1291.
- [6]A. Singh, W.J. Dally, and A.K. Gupta, "Adaptive Channel Queue Routing on K-ary N-cubes," Proc. 16th ACM Symp. Parallelism in Algorithms and Architectures, 2004, pp. 11-19.
- [7]K.V. Anjan and T.M. Pinkston, "DISHA: A Deadlock Recovery Scheme for Fully Adaptive Routing," Proc. 9th Int’l Parallel Processing Symp., Apr. 1995, pp. 537-543.